2012-03-25 168 views
5

我需要同时播放和录制。问题是播放和录制的声音应该不同。播放的声音_1通过耳机插孔连续发送到连接的设备,设备分析此声音_1并通过耳机插孔发回另一个声音_2。我收到了这个sound_2,但是当我尝试记录它时,我会混合使用sound_1和sound_2。有没有什么办法分开播放/录制,或者我需要某种过滤器来接收传入的sound_2?我试图用AVAudioPlayer播放声音并用AudioQueue录制,会话是PlayAndRecord。同时播放和录制音频

发现了一些类似的话题:Playing and recording Audio simutaneouly with headset jack pin in iOS?

但也有没有建设性的答案。

回答

1

对我来说,解决方案是将采样率从44100降低到22050